Training Builds More Than Shooting Skills

Quality Self defense firearm training Illinois gives students far more than basic target practice. It teaches safe gun handling, how to understand your firearm, how to improve accuracy, and how to respond more effectively under pressure. In a real-world defensive situation, fundamentals matter. Grip, stance, trigger control, reloads, and decision-making all play a role in how prepared someone really is.

Many people assume buying a firearm is enough. In reality, ownership without training can create bad habits and false confidence. That is why Self defense firearm training Illinois is essential for people who want to be more capable, safer, and more informed. Training helps students understand not only how to shoot, but when to shoot, when not to shoot, and how to think through defensive scenarios with greater clarity.

FAQs

What is included in self defense firearm training?

Most self defense firearm training includes safe handling, range safety, shooting fundamentals, defensive mindset, firearm operation, and practical drills designed to improve real-world readiness.

Is self defense firearm training in Illinois only for beginners?

No. Beginners benefit from building a strong foundation, but experienced shooters also benefit from improving technique, correcting bad habits, and staying sharp through continued practice.

Does self defense firearm training help with concealed carry preparation?

Yes. Self defense firearm training is highly beneficial for anyone interested in concealed carry because it improves safety, confidence, legal awareness, and practical defensive shooting skills.

Why is professional firearm training better than learning on your own?

Professional training provides structured instruction, supervised practice, immediate feedback, and a safer learning environment, which helps students progress faster and avoid developing poor habits.
